Shower room flooring


Attempt to prevent need to put carpets on the washroom floor, according to the study it is not as well favoured. The survey showed that the favored flooring covering was ceramic tiles, with 75 percent stating they "loved" a tiled shower room floor. Popular plastic flooring has actually not yet lost its area in the bathroom, with greater than 61 per cent stating they didn't have any type of strong sort or dislikes towards it.
When picking your bathroom floor covering, tiles is the favoured alternative, but if the budget plan is limited, then plastic flooring will not allow you down.
Aside from the floor covering, make sure your windows look appealing. When it involves clothing your restroom home windows, steer clear of those shower room nets as well as textile curtains. The survey revealed that 94 per cent stated they favoured blinds in the shower room to drapes.

Shower power


When intending the layout of your bathroom, one of the most essential facets to take into consideration is placing a shower. Some bathrooms don't have appropriate room to consist of a shower work area, so assess your options. Consider installing a shower over the bath if area is limited.
The study revealed that 94 percent of its individuals believed that a shower in a bathroom was really vital, and also 81 percent claimed they favored a separate shower enclosure in a large restroom. Practically 65 per cent stated their suitable would certainly be a power shower, while 27 percent liked mixer showers, as well as only 12 per cent chose electric showers.
If you have selected a shower over the bath, then think about placing a fixed glass display rather than a shower drape. It might set you back a couple of added pounds, but majority of the survey's factors preferred a set glass screen to a shower curtain.

Choosing your bath tub


As opposed to typical belief, including a whirlpool bath to enhance residential property worth does not constantly suffice. So if you're pondering offering your home, try to avoid purchasing a whirlpool bath in the hopes of obtaining extra revenue.
The survey revealed that near to 53 per cent of its participants were not phased by them, while only a tiny 38 percent of individuals "loved" them. Remarkably, 62 percent stated they had "no strong sight" in the direction of corner baths either, which suggests the standard rectangular baths still hold influence against their improved counter parts.

Hi simplicity


From as far back as the 1960s much focus was positioned on strong colour in the restroom. Patterned wall surface floor tiles of maritime creatures and over-the-top colours were the pattern, together with plastic. Plastic bathroom decor was the trend, from bold orange, olive environment-friendly, mustard yellow as well as chocolate brownish coloured toothbrush, soap and towel owners, to thick patterned plastic shower drapes that yelled colours of the boldest nature.
As the times went on, the 1970s as well as very early 1980s ended up being a duration when gold restroom correctings as well as equipping, such as taps, towel rails as well as toilet roll holders, were taken into consideration extremely trendy. These ostentatious gold cut features were all the rage, and also restroom decor was 'loud'. Contributed to this were those once wonderful washroom suites in colours avocado, reefs pink, as well as delicious chocolate brown. Shower room colour has altered dramatically over the past years, and also shades have actually become a lot more neutral, sometimes with a hint of colour that includes a complementary vigour to the general system.
Of the many numerous individuals that took part in Plumbworld's current bathroom study, a frustrating 82 per cent stated they "hated" the when pietistic avocado and also coral pink shower room collections, colours residue of 1970s as well as 1980s, which are normally characterised as being dark and also dull.
According to the survey, chrome shower room faucets were much preferred to gold.
So, when developing as well as enhancing your bathroom keep those dark colours away, take into consideration white suites, as well as select chrome fixings as well as furnishings as opposed to showy gold.

7 Smart Strategies for Bathroom Remodeling


You dream about a bathroom that’s high on comfort and personal style, but you also want materials, fixtures, and amenities with lasting value. Wake up! You can have both.



A midrange bathroom remodel is a solid investment, according to the “Remodeling Impact Report” from the NATIONAL ASSOCIATION OF REALTORS®. A bath remodel with a national median cost of 30,000 will recover about 50% of those costs when it’s time to sell your home.



Regardless of payback potential, you’ll probably be glad you went ahead and updated your bathroom. Homeowners polled for the report gave their bathroom renovation a Joy Score of 9.6 — a rating based on those who said they were happy or satisfied with their project, with 10 being the highest rating and 1 the lowest.


Stick to a Plan


A bathroom remodel is no place for improvisation. Before ripping out the first tile, think hard about how you will use the space, what materials and fixtures you want, and how much you’re willing to spend.



The National Kitchen and Bath Association recommends spending up to six months evaluating and planning before beginning work. That way, you have a roadmap that will guide decisions, even the ones made under remodeling stress. Once work has begun — a process that averages two to three months — resist changing your mind. Work stoppages and alterations add costs. Some contractors include clauses in their contracts that specify premium prices for changing original plans.



If planning isn’t your strong suit, hire a designer. In addition to adding style and efficiency, a professional designer makes sure contractors and installers are scheduled in an orderly fashion. Hiring a bathroom designer costs 50 to 200 per hour for a consultation, and 1,200 to 4,800 (5% to 10% of the project) for a complete design.


Keep the Same Footprint


You can afford that Italian tile you love if you can live with the total square footage you already have.



Keeping the same footprint, and locating new plumbing fixtures near existing plumbing pipes, saves demolition and reconstruction dollars. You’ll also cut down on the dust and debris that make remodeling so hard to live with.



Make the most of the space you have. Glass doors on showers and tubs open up the area. A pedestal sink takes up less room than a vanity. If you miss the storage, replace a mirror with a deep medicine cabinet.


Make Lighting a Priority


Multiple shower heads and radiant heat floors are fabulous adds to a bathroom remodel. But few items make a bathroom more satisfying than lighting designed for everyday grooming. You can install lighting for a fraction of the cost of pricier amenities.



Well-designed bathroom task lighting surrounds vanity mirrors and eliminates shadows on faces: You look better already. The scheme includes two ceiling- or soffit-mounted fixtures, and side fixtures or sconces distributed vertically across 24 inches (to account for people of various heights). Four-bulb lighting fixtures work well for side lighting.



Today, shopping for bulbs means paying attention to lumens, the amount of light you get from a bulb — i.e., brightness. For these bathroom task areas, the Lighting Research Center recommends:


  • Toilet: 45 lumens


  • Sink: 450 lumens


  • Vanity: 1,680 lumens


  • Clear the Air


    Bathroom ventilation systems may be out of sight, but they shouldn’t be out of mind during a bathroom remodel.



    Bathroom ventilation is essential for removing excess humidity that fogs mirrors, makes bathroom floors slippery, and contributes to the growth of mildew and mold. Controlling mold and humidity is especially important for maintaining healthy indoor air quality and protecting the value of your home — mold remediation is expensive, and excess humidity can damage cabinets and painted finishes.



    A bathroom vent and water closet fan should exhaust air to the outside — not simply to the space between ceiling joists. Better models have whisper-quiet exhaust fans and humidity-controlled switches that activate when a sensor detects excess moisture in the air.



    Think Storage


    Bathroom storage is a challenge: By the time you’ve installed the toilet, shower, and sink, there’s often little space left to store towels, toilet paper, and hair and body products. Here are some ways to find storage in hidden places.


  • Think vertically: Upper wall space in a bathroom is often underused. Freestanding, multi-tiered shelf units designed to fit over toilet tanks turn unused wall area into found storage. Spaces between wall studs create attractive and useful niches for holding soaps and toiletries. Install shelves over towel bars to use blank wall space.


  • Think movable: Inexpensive woven baskets set on the floor are stylish towel holders. A floor-stand coat rack holds wet towels, bath robes, and clothes.


  • Think utility: Adding a slide-out tray to vanity cabinet compartments provides full access to stored items and prevents lesser-used items from being lost or forgotten.

  • Contribute Sweat Equity


    Shave labor costs by doing some work yourself. Tell your contractor which projects you’ll handle, so there are no misunderstandings later.


  • Install window and baseboard trim; save 250.


  • Paint walls and trim, 200 square feet; save 200.


  • Install toilet; save 150.


  • Install towel bars and shelves; save 20 each.


  • Choose Low-Cost Design for High Visual Impact


    A “soft scheme” adds visual zest to your bathroom, but doesn’t create a one-of-a-kind look that might scare away future buyers.



    Soft schemes employ neutral colors for permanent fixtures and surfaces, then add pizzazz with items that are easily changed, such as shower curtains, window treatments, towels, throw rugs, and wall colors. These relatively low-cost decorative touches provide tons of personality but are easy to redo whenever you want.
